330ml bottle. Filmy golden colour with average, frothy, half-way lasting, minimally lacing, white head. Spicy aroma has notes of ginger, lime, a peppery touch, cilantro. Taste is initially minimally sweet, spicy, notes of ginger with a soapy touch, later more dry and sourish, hints of lime, cilantro, in the finish minimally peppery. Refreshing, well balanced, maybe slightly too soapy due to the ginger extra benefit.
